I have a Tivo HD with Comcast and a single M-Card.

A few weeks ago the Tivo stopped receiving some channels in the 44-64 band. The missing channels include MSNBC, Fox News, USA, VH1 and Lifetime, but we still receive CNN, and MTV, which are also between 44 and 64. When selecting one of these channels, the guide data is there, but we see a black screen and a message saying "no signal."

I have verified on the comcast website that all these channels are part of a package we subscribe to. These channels also come when using the TV's tuner, and on other TVs in the house, and on a Series I Tivo in another room. The picture quality on the missing channels when not tuned in on TiVo looks the same as channels we do receive. Also, no HD channels are affected, including HD versions of some of the missing channels. I don't think it is a signal strength issue.

BTW, I have resarted, but have not removed the cable card. Is re-pairing the card the next step?

Possibly your cable company is in the midst of implementing ADS and your cablecard map was never updated. Happened to me a year ago.

I'm having almost the exact same problem in Newark, OH. A couple weeks ago some hd, digital, and analog channels started showing a black screen with a message like "searching for signal (cable)". They seem to be gone in banks with analog missing channel 14-20 and 32-64. All of the sd digital channels are gone. On the HD side i'm missing cbs while nbc, abc, and fox come in full signal strength. Then espn 1 & 2 don't come in while hdnet and other encrypted digital channels do.

At first I thought the cable card mapping had got messed up but I've totally erased the tivo which is supposed to unpair the cable cards. I took the cards out, cleared everything, and I'm still missing the analog channels.

The odd part is that the higher bank of analog channels that are missing. If I leave the tivo on some of them they'll flash on and off randomly to like channel 32, no matter what channel I'm trying to tune in.

All of these channels work fine on my sd tivo and on my tv where cbs hd hasn't changed the channel its broadcast on (no cable card in tv). All 3 devices are wired to the same splitter with the hd tivo getting the higher output tap.
